引言:tpwallet作为下一代数字资产管理与交互端,既要兼顾私密与合规,也要在合约模拟、市场判断、金融创新、底层实现与审计可追溯性上取得平衡。下面从六个维度系统探讨其前景与实现要点。
1. 私密资金管理
要点:非托管优先、可验证的多方安全、灵活的策略控制。实现路径包括阈值签名(TSS/MPC)、硬件安全模块(HSM)或可信执行环境(TEE)的混合部署;引入策略引擎实现分级签名、延时签名和授权白名单;支持可审计的脱敏日志、可恢复的加密备份与密钥隔离。对机构用户,提供账户抽象、角色与权限管理(RBAC/ABAC)和合规打点(KYC/AML数据隔离)。

2. 合约模拟
要点:在链上操作前保证行为可预测且安全。实现包括离线/在线沙箱模拟器(支持EVM/WASM等)、状态快照和回放、燃气与滑点估计、对抗性测试(模糊测试)与形式化验证接口。集成模拟链、静态分析器与符号执行器,给用户和策略引擎提供交易风险评分与回滚建议。
3. 市场评估
要点:用户需求、竞争地图、监管环境与流动性结构。tpwallet应定位为“可组合的钱包中枢”:连接DeFi、CeFi桥梁与传统资产。评估指标包括用户留存、TVL、交易频次、平均手续费、链上/链下业务占比。需关注监管合规性、跨链标准进展与大型钱包厂商的产品路线。
4. 创新金融模式
要点:基于钱包的产品化创新空间大。可探索:内置流动性池与闪兑、信用钱包(基于历史行为的可撤销信用额度)、分布式托管理财、按策略收费的收益聚合、NFT与实物资产的Tokenize入口、钱包即服务(WaaS)和API订阅商业化。商业模式应兼顾平台费、交易费和企业定制服务。
5. Golang实现优势与实践
要点:Golang适合高并发、轻量部署与跨平台后端。工程实践包括:使用成熟的加密库(libsodium、go-ethereum crypto)、模块化微服务架构、GRPC/REST兼容、并发安全的事务队列、热热升级与进程隔离。Golang在二进制交付、容器化和性能调优上能显著降低运维成本;需注意内存管理、GC调优与长期审核的依赖安全。
6. 交易审计
要点:可验证、可追溯与隐私保护的审计体系。实现包括链上指纹与链下Merkle树索引、可证明的日志完整性(append-only ledger)、事件时间线与证据打包(anchor to public chain)。对合规场景提供可选择的解密通道、审计委托簽章与法庭友好导出格式。引入连续审计(CI for transactions)、差错检测与告警机制。

结语:tpwallet的长远前景取决于其在私密性与合规性之间找到技术与商业的平衡,同时通过强大的合约模拟、基于Golang的高可用后端与透明的审计体系打造差异化竞争力。结合可扩展的金融创新能力,tpwallet有望成为连接用户、机构与多链生态的入口。
评论
Alice
内容全面,尤其认同把MPC和可审计日志结合起来的思路。
张宇
想了解更多关于Golang在高并发交易队列中的具体实现案例。
CryptoFan88
合约模拟那部分很实用,建议补充对跨链桥攻击防护的策略。
王小明
建议进一步展开信用钱包如何量化风险与违约控制。
Luna
交易审计的链外Merkle索引思路很好,期待开源工具链。